A. consequences B. dedicated C. deduces D. engaged E. explanations
F. fallen G. inequality H. intellectual I. modifying J. persistently
K. repetitive L. symbolizes M. take N. updating O. zealously
For most of human history rich people had the most leisure. On the flip side, the poor had to work 【C1】______. Hans-Joachim Voth, an economic historian, says that in 19th century you could tell how poor somebody was by how long they worked. Today things are different. Overall working hours have 【C2】______ over the past century. But the rich have begun to work longer hours than the poor.
There are a number of 【C3】______. One is that higher wages make leisure more expensive: if people take time off they give up more money. Since the 1980s the salaries of those at the top have risen strongly, while those below the median have stood still or fallen. Thus rising 【C4】______ encourages the rich to work more and the poor to work less.
The status of work and leisure in the rich world has also changed. Back in 1899 Thorstein Ve- blen offered his 【C5】______ on things. He argued that leisure was a "badge of honor". Rich people could get others to do the dirty, 【C6】______ work. Yet Veblen’s leisure class was not idle. Rather they 【C7】______ in "exploit": challenging and creative activities such as writing, charity and debating.
Veblen’s theory needs 【C8】______. Work in advanced economies has become more knowledge-intensive and 【C9】______. There are fewer really dull jobs, like lift-operating, and more glamorous ones, like fashion design. That means more people than ever can enjoy "exploit" at the office. Work has come to offer the sort of pleasures that rich people used to seek in their leisure time. On the other hand, leisure is no longer a sign of social power. Instead it 【C10】______ uselessness and unemployment. [br] 【C1】
选项
答案
J
解析
空格所在句主要句子成分完整,空格处可填入副词,修饰动词work。由句中On the flip side“(行动、观点等的)反面”可知,空格所在句与文章首句语义形成对比。文章首句提到,从人类历史来看,多数时候,富人都是最闲的。因此空格所在句讲的是过去的穷人要整天辛勤劳作,词库中副词persistently“一直”符合语义,故选J项。zealously“热心地,积极地”符合此处语法要求,但语义不通,故排除。
